Understanding Thermage FLX
Thermage FLX utilizes radiofrequency technology to stimulate collagen production, which in turn helps to tighten and rejuvenate the skin. This treatment is suitable for various areas of the body, including the face, eyes, abdomen, and thighs. The procedure is known for its minimal downtime and long-lasting effects, making it a preferred choice for many in the Bay Area.
Recommended Treatment Frequency
The frequency of Thermage FLX treatments can vary based on individual skin conditions, age, and the specific areas being treated. Generally, it is recommended to undergo a Thermage FLX treatment every 1 to 2 years. This interval allows the skin to continue producing collagen and maintain the tightening effects without overloading the skin with repeated treatments.
Factors Influencing Treatment Frequency
Several factors can influence how often you should get Thermage FLX treatments:
- Skin Type and Condition: Individuals with thicker skin or those who are dealing with significant skin laxity may require more frequent treatments. Conversely, those with normal skin elasticity might achieve longer-lasting results with less frequent treatments.
- Age: Younger individuals typically have more resilient skin and may not need Thermage FLX as frequently as older adults. As collagen production naturally declines with age, older patients might benefit from more regular treatments.
- Lifestyle and Habits: Factors such as sun exposure, smoking, and diet can affect skin health. Individuals who lead a healthy lifestyle might maintain their results for longer periods, reducing the need for frequent treatments.
Safety and Side Effects
Thermage FLX is generally considered safe, with most patients experiencing only mild side effects such as redness or swelling immediately after the treatment. However, it is essential to follow the recommended treatment frequency to avoid potential overtreatment, which could lead to more severe side effects or compromised skin health.

FAQ
Q: How long do the results of Thermage FLX last?
A: The results of Thermage FLX can last up to 2 years, depending on individual factors such as skin type and lifestyle.
Q: Is Thermage FLX painful?
A: Most patients report only mild discomfort during the treatment. The Thermage FLX device includes a cooling mechanism to minimize any pain or discomfort.
Q: Can Thermage FLX be used on all skin types?
A: Yes, Thermage FLX is safe for all skin types and colors, making it a versatile option for individuals in San Francisco.
Q: What should I do after a Thermage FLX treatment?
A: After the treatment, it is recommended to avoid sun exposure and use sunscreen to protect the newly stimulated collagen. Normal activities can be resumed immediately.
